Abstract
PURPOSE:To add analog signals of many differential amplifiers by connecting differential amplifiers supplied with input signals and those applied with reference voltages mutually by common load resistances. CONSTITUTION:Couples of transistor (TR) 4 and 5, 6 and 7, and 8 and 9 are provided in such a way that the TRs 4, 6 and 8 on a signal input side and TRs 5, 7 and 9 on a reference power source side are connected to common loads 36 and 37 respectively. Therefore, voltages based upon input signals 1-3 to the TRs on the signal input side are added together to cause a voltage drop across the load resistance 36. Similarly, currents based upon reference voltages 13-15 are added together to cause an added voltage drop across the load resistance 37. On the other hand, resistances 22, 25, 28, and 29 and an operational amplifier 30 constitute an adding and subtracting circuit which inputs (1)s as an addition and a subtraction input and a difference in signal voltage between the load resistances 36 and 37 is found, so that a signal removed from a DC component appears at an output terminal OUT.
